> 24 hourThis garment bag has several great features and essentially turns itself into a small duffle bag. This has to be one of the cleverest garment bags ever made. When opened up you have room for a suit with all the hanger holders and appropriate elastic tie downs. when the classic garment portion is zipped up you have separate zippered pockets, one for ties and such and another larger zippered storage area perhaps for dirty laundry. when the end tabs are zippered up the garment bag forms itself into a duffle bag with a good amount of inside storage. Further, after completely zippered up there are outside pockets. This thing is ideal for an overnight trip. The external material is a vinal-ized fabric of sorts which is waterproof protecting your suit against damage, the inside is a nylon material. I am very pleased with this product and will use it for short trips.

> 24 hourThe concept for this garment/duffel bag is great, but it didn’t quite deliver when put to the test. As you can see in the pictures, it seems pretty spacious. Because of that, I was really looking forward to using it for a 2-night getaway. I put two long (and rather bulky) cardigans in the garment section. Everything zipped up just as shown in the video. The problem was, due to the thickness of the sweaters, I lost a lot of interior packing space. It was like a Tardis with an inferiority complex…this actually ended up being *smaller* on the inside than it looked like it should be. I wasn’t packing a whole lot of stuff but, when I tried to get my toiletries, shoes and folded clothes in the duffle bag section, it was too full to zip closed. I wound up having to pack an additional bag, which I was hoping to avoid. The quality of this bag is nice, and I think it will hold up, but it falls short when it comes to packing space. At least that’s the case if you’re putting anything bulky in the garment section. The good thing is, it will probably accommodate a lot more articles of clothing for warm weather trips since those items tend to be lightweight. Live and learn, I guess.

> 24 hourAll images are of the garment bag empty* This bag is nice. It looks casual and yet refined enough for business trips. The zipper details on the sides are of faux leather that seems nice but looks weird with the shine from the (nylon?) straps. It holds its shape well without anything inside. There are 5 zip pockets (3 on the outside, 1 long but shallow pocket inside, and 1 large deep pouch inside) plus an open pocket under the brand tag. The connection on the top of the bag for the side zips is covered by the faux leather flap but has nothing else to stop them from moving or opening while in transit. For a carry-on, that might not be that big of an issue, but if the bag is going to be shuffled around more, I can see that possibly being an issue that the zippers start opening on their own. The zippers themselves are a pretty standard build and not flimsy. All the other hardware seems like metal that isnt overly hearty. The inside lining is very thin and has a golden tan color. The shallow zipper pocket is held down by two snap buttons and reveals two snap straps and a loop for securing your garment hanger. There are two straps to hold down your garments inside the garment area (which you can see on the bottom of the bag) and goes until the deep zipper pouch. That folds down and is secured by velcro. I dont expect any garment bag to keep my clothes 100% wrinkle-free (especially having to fold into the shape of the bag) but it was convenient to use in this bag. Overall theres not a lot of padding in the bag (hence why it is a carry-on bag in the description), so if you have anything particularly fragile, it will not protect it. The duffle is a nice size and Im delighted.
